The songwriter also pays special tribute to his fallen friend,
Chief Warrant Officer 3, Donovan L. "Bull" Briley, U.S. Army Night Stalkers, who was Killed In Action, October 3, 1993, during the Battle of Mogadishu as depicted in both the book and movie Blackhawk Down.

(SONGWRITER'S NOTE) - (Berets wrong color?)
The songwriter has a line in the song's chorus that says, "The Bull, he wore a Green Beret", when the Night Stalker's berets are really, maroon in color.
The songwriter made the berets green in the song because he said Mr. Briley always carried himself like John Wayne in the 1968 movie, "The Green Berets".
The songwriter graduated U.S. Army WOEC with Mr. Briley, as well as sharing a room with him in U.S. Army flight school.

THE MISSION
While leading a multi-aircraft flight on the assault of an objective in downtown Mogadishu, Somalia on October 3th 1993, the Black Hawk helicopter, "SUPER 6-1" (#91-26324) flown by CW4 Clifton P. Wolcott and CW3 Donovan L. Briley was struck by an RPG and crashed.
